How knife gate valves work
A knife gate valve achieves shut-off using a thin, flat stainless steel gate (blade) that slides vertically across the pipe bore, cutting through solids and fibres in the fluid stream as it closes. The sharp lower edge of the blade acts like a knife, slicing through fibrous biomass, sludge or slurries that would jam a conventional gate valve. When fully open, the gate retracts completely behind the packing gland, leaving the pipe bore unobstructed (full-bore) and allowing free passage of solids-laden flow.
Sealing is achieved by a resilient elastomeric seat (EPDM, NBR or polyurethane) moulded or inserted into the valve body, against which the bottom edge and sides of the blade press when closed. Some designs use an external compression-type packing (stuffing box) around the gate to handle leakage past the gate in the vertical direction — especially for high-solids slurries under pressure.
Knife gate valves are available in DN 50 to DN 600 and are offered in wafer pattern (the most compact, sandwiched between flanges), lug pattern (allowing end-of-line installation) and flanged pattern. Technical specifications
- Size range: DN 50 to DN 600 standard; DN 700–1200 on request
- Pressure rating: PN 6–16 standard; PN 25 for special orders
- Body: ductile iron GGG40, AISI 304/316, carbon steel
- Blade: AISI 304, 316, 416 (hardened); hardfaced on request
- Seat: EPDM, NBR, NBR+fabric, polyurethane, PTFE
- End connections: wafer, lug, flanged (EN 1092-1 / ANSI B16.5)
- Actuation: manual handwheel, gear, pneumatic, electric, hydraulic

Knife gate valves in biogas plants
In biogas and biomethane plants, knife gate valves are among the most critical components. They are used on substrate feed lines (where raw biomass — maize silage, organic food waste, animal slurries — enters the process), on digestate discharge lines (isolation of the digester for maintenance), on inter-tank transfer lines and on effluent treatment stages where solids concentrations are high. The biogas sector demands valves that can achieve adequate shut-off against methane-rich biogas (preventing fugitive GHG emissions) while handling fibrous and abrasive slurries.
